Sunlight: The Primary Natural Source

For most people, the sun is the most significant natural source of vitamin D. When the sun’s ultraviolet B (UVB) rays strike exposed skin, they interact with a form of cholesterol, providing the energy needed to trigger vitamin D synthesis. This is why vitamin D is often referred to as the “sunshine vitamin.” The amount of vitamin D the body can produce from sun exposure is influenced by several key factors:

  • Time of day: Midday sun provides the most intense UVB rays, meaning shorter exposure times are needed to produce sufficient vitamin D.
  • Latitude and season: Locations far from the equator receive less intense sunlight, especially during winter months, which can significantly limit vitamin D production. For example, during winter, individuals in northern climates may not be able to produce any vitamin D from sunlight.
  • Skin pigmentation: The amount of melanin in the skin affects how much vitamin D is produced. People with darker skin have more melanin, which acts as a natural sunscreen and reduces the skin’s ability to synthesize vitamin D from sunlight. As a result, they may need more sun exposure to achieve adequate levels.
  • Use of sunscreen: Sunscreen with an SPF of 15 or more can block vitamin D-producing UV rays. While vital for preventing skin cancer, this protective measure can also reduce synthesis. However, real-world application often results in some synthesis still occurring.

Experts recommend limiting unprotected sun exposure to minimize the risk of skin cancer while still allowing for some vitamin D production.

Natural Food Sources of Vitamin D

While sun exposure is a powerful source, very few foods naturally contain significant levels of vitamin D. The most potent food sources are animal-based, particularly fatty fish. Some mushrooms are a notable non-animal source, but their vitamin D content depends on exposure to UV light. Obtaining sufficient vitamin D from natural (non-fortified) food sources alone is difficult for many individuals.

List of Natural Vitamin D Foods

Here are some of the best natural food sources of vitamin D, containing primarily vitamin D3 unless noted otherwise:

  • Fatty Fish: Excellent sources include wild-caught salmon, mackerel, tuna, and sardines.
  • Cod Liver Oil: This oil, derived from fish liver, is a highly concentrated source of vitamin D.
  • Egg Yolks: The yolks from chickens that are free-range or whose feed has been supplemented with vitamin D contain higher levels of the nutrient.
  • Mushrooms: Certain types, such as cremini and wild mushrooms, can produce vitamin D2 when exposed to UV light. Some commercially grown mushrooms are treated with UV light to increase their vitamin D content.
  • Beef Liver: Provides a small amount of vitamin D.

The Importance of Fortified Foods

Because natural food sources are limited, many countries fortify common foods with vitamin D to help address public health needs. While these are not strictly "natural" in the sense of being found in the raw ingredient, they are a vital source in modern diets.

  • Fortified milk (cow's, soy, almond, and oat)
  • Fortified breakfast cereals
  • Some orange juice and yogurt brands

How to Optimize Your Natural Vitamin D Intake

Integrating natural vitamin D sources into your lifestyle requires a balanced approach. While sunlight is a powerful producer, relying on it alone can be risky due to skin cancer concerns and limited exposure during certain months or in specific locations. Combining controlled sun exposure with a diet rich in natural and fortified foods is the most practical strategy.

  • Aim for 5–30 minutes of unprotected midday sun exposure a few times per week, depending on skin type and location, to facilitate natural production. For extended time outdoors, use sunscreen.
  • Prioritize fatty fish like salmon or mackerel in your meals. A single serving can provide a significant portion of your daily needs.
  • Incorporate other animal sources like eggs and beef liver into your diet for smaller, but still beneficial, amounts.
  • Look for UV-treated mushrooms at your grocery store, as these are an excellent source of plant-based vitamin D.
  • Read food labels to identify fortified products such as milk, cereal, and orange juice.
